Make Ahead and Storage

Storing Leftovers

After enjoying your meal, store le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to three days. The flavors actually intensify overnight, making your next serving even tastier.

Freezing

This Cheeseburger Pie Recipe freezes wonderfully! Wrap the pie tightly in foil or plastic wrap and place it in a freezer-safe container or bag for up to two months. Thaw overnight in the fridge before reheating to preserve the texture and flavor.

Reheating

Reheat your pie gently in a 350°F oven for about 15-20 minutes or until warmed through. Using the oven keeps that crispy crust intact better than a microwave, which can sometimes leave the crust soggy.

FAQs

Can I use fresh hash browns for the crust?

Absolutely! You can grate fresh potatoes, but be sure to squeeze out as much moisture as possible to get that perfect crispy crust just like with frozen hash browns.

Is butternut squash necessary in this recipe?

While butternut squash adds a lovely sweetness and texture contrast, you can substitute it with diced carrots or leave it out altogether if preferred, although it does enhance the overall flavor.

Can I make this recipe vegetarian?

Yes! Replace the ground beef with plant-based crumbles or cooked lentils and use vegetable broth instead of beef broth for a delicious vegetarian twist on the Cheeseburger Pie Recipe.

What type of cheese works best?

Sharp cheddar cheese melts beautifully and offers a classic cheeseburger flavor, but you could also experiment with a mix of mozzarella and cheddar for a creamier texture.

How can I make this recipe gluten-free?

This recipe is naturally gluten-free as long as you ensure your beef broth and ketchup are free of gluten-containing ingredients, making it perfect for gluten-sensitive guests.

Ingredients

Scale

Crust and Base

  • 16-ounce bag shredded hash browns, frozen
  • 1 tablespoon oil
  • 2 teaspoons salt, divided
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ground black pepper

Filling

  • 1 cup (5 ounces) finely diced butternut squash
  • 11/4 teaspoon garlic powder, divided
  • 1/4 teaspoon ground black pepper
  • 3/4 cup (3 ounces) shredded sharp cheddar cheese
  • 1 lb. ground beef
  • 1 medium onion, very finely diced
  • 2 tablespoons ketchup
  • 1 tablespoon mustard
  • 1 teaspoon cornstarch
  • 1/2 cup beef broth
  • 1/2 cup milk


Instructions

  1. Prepare the Hash Brown Crust: Preheat your oven and lightly grease a baking dish. In a bowl, toss the frozen shredded hash browns with 1 tablespoon of oil, 1 teaspoon of salt, and 1/2 teaspoon of black pepper. Press the hash browns evenly into the bottom of the prepared baking dish to form the crust.
  2. Bake the Crust: Bake the hash brown crust in the oven for about 20 minutes or until they begin to crisp and set. This will help create a sturdy base for the pie.
  3. Cook the Ground Beef Mixture: While the crust is baking, heat a skillet over medium heat. Add the ground beef and diced onion, cooking until the beef is browned and onions are softened. Drain any excess fat. Stir in the ketchup, mustard, 1/4 teaspoon black pepper, 1 teaspoon garlic powder, and 1/2 cup beef broth.
  4. Thicken the Filling: In a small bowl, mix the cornstarch with milk until smooth. Pour this mixture into the beef mixture, stirring constantly until the sauce thickens, about 2-3 minutes. Add the finely diced butternut squash and cook until the squash softens but is not mushy, around 5 minutes.
  5. Assemble the Pie: Remove the hash brown crust from the oven. Spoon the beef and squash filling evenly over the crust. Sprinkle the top with the shredded sharp cheddar cheese and the remaining 1/4 teaspoon garlic powder and 1 teaspoon salt for extra flavor.
  6. Bake the Cheeseburger Pie: Return the assembled pie to the oven and bake for an additional 20-25 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and bubbly and the filling is heated through.
  7. Rest and Serve: Let the pie rest for about 5 minutes after baking to set. Slice into 4 portions and serve warm for a delicious, hearty meal.

Notes

  • For a crispier crust, you can broil the hash browns for the last 2 minutes before adding the filling.
  • You can substitute ground turkey or chicken for a leaner version.
  • Adding a few dashes of Worcestershire sauce to the beef mixture can enhance the savory flavor.
  • If butternut squash is unavailable, diced potatoes or carrots can be used as a substitute.
  • This pie can be made ahead and refrigerated; reheat covered in the oven before serving.
